RFID Attendance System

A smart attendance solution where students can register their personal information and are assigned both a QR code and RFID tag. The system allows students to log their attendance (in and out) using either their RFID or QR code, while administrators can manage and monitor student data efficiently.

RFID Attendance System Main Interface

Project Overview

The RFID Attendance System streamlines the process of tracking student attendance. Students register their personal details and are provided with a unique QR code and RFID tag. They can easily record their attendance by scanning either their QR code or tapping their RFID card on the reader.

The system automatically logs in and out times, reducing manual errors and saving time for both students and staff. Administrators have access to a dashboard where they can view, update, and manage student records and attendance logs.

This solution is ideal for schools and organizations seeking a secure, efficient, and paperless way to manage attendance.

Technology Stack

Python (Flask)
HTML
CSS
JavaScript
MySQL
RFID Hardware
QR Code
Tailwind CSS

Key Features

Student Registration

Students can register their personal information and are assigned a unique QR code and RFID tag for attendance.

RFID & QR Code Attendance

Students can log their attendance (in and out) by scanning their QR code or tapping their RFID card.

Admin Management

Admins can manage student data, view attendance logs, and update records through a secure dashboard.

Real-Time Notifications

Instant feedback for successful or failed attendance scans, helping students and staff stay informed.

Attendance Reports

Generate daily, weekly, or monthly attendance reports for monitoring and compliance.

Secure & Reliable

Ensures data privacy and integrity with secure authentication and access controls.

Screenshots

Screenshot 1
Screenshot 2
Screenshot 3
Screenshot 4
Screenshot 5
Screenshot 6
Screenshot 7
Screenshot 8
Screenshot 9
Screenshot 10
Screenshot 11
Screenshot 12